## Artifact signing — RateVault lookup cache

For the weekly sync: RateVault cache snapshots are now signed before upload to the distribution bucket. Verification runs on every node at load time, and unsigned snapshots are rejected outright. Rotation happens quarterly; the build bot handles resigning automatically. The current snapshot signing key is listed below for reference.

signing key of bagap-yawep = bky13_TbfT6ZMUoGJo2

## Changelog — PayLoom Retry Service v4.2.0

Changed defaults: idempotency keys for payment retries are now generated server-side using a per-tenant namespace rather than trusting client-supplied keys. Client keys are still accepted but are validated against the namespace and rejected on mismatch. Key TTL was shortened to reduce the replay window, and collisions now fail closed. Reviewers should confirm the defaults below match the threat model sign-off. The new shipped defaults are as follows.

deployment values, fahap-hahaf:
[casdor]
port = 9200
region = south-2
host = casdor.qirvanworks.corp
timeout_ms = 3000
retries = 4

Board,

Sale of the Kestrel instrumentation unit to Halloway Industrial is moving to final diligence. Headline price holds at the figure discussed in March. Two open items: retention packages for the Brindle site engineers, and carve-out of the shared tooling contracts. Both should close within ten business days. No leaks — staff communications are drafted but embargoed until signing. Counsel confirms no regulatory hurdles. Rationale and next-phase allocation of proceeds are captured in the confidential note below.

board note of bawep-tajef: Queniusek Systems plans to raise the Quenvan list price by 53.1 percent in March. The pricing group signed off on a budget of $176.4 million for Project Drueth. The renewal with Casionix Partners closes at $142.5 million a year, 8.3 percent below the last contract. Project Fraax slips by six weeks because of the tooling delay.

### Largediff API — Support Notes

The Burlop diff viewer streams comparisons for files up to 4 GB via chunked responses. If a customer reports truncated diffs, check the `chunk-complete` trailer first. Support tooling can replay any session through the internal replay endpoint, which authenticates with the key below.

API key for yahig-tadup: kto7_ubizbYm